What to know
Denver gig workers usually get stuck in one of three places: deciding whether to stay a sole prop or form an LLC, figuring out what counts as a write-off, or building a system that keeps estimated taxes from blowing up cash flow. The right guide depends on which of those is actually causing the problem, because the fix is different in each case.
A useful way to sort it out is to look at the decision that changes your taxes the most, not the one that sounds most advanced. If you are mainly trying to understand LLC vs sole proprietorship for gig workers, you are choosing a legal and bookkeeping structure, not just a tax form. If your issue is spend tracking and deductions, start with how to track business expenses for taxes or a freelancer tax write-offs list so you can separate legitimate business costs from personal spending before tax season gets messy. If your income is uneven month to month, the immediate problem is usually cash flow management, not a software choice.

The trap for Denver freelancers is trying to optimize everything at once. A rideshare driver with predictable vehicle costs, a creative freelancer with software and gear expenses, and a contractor with irregular project invoices will not need the same sequence. The wrong sequence usually means paying for tools before the books are clean, or choosing an entity before you know whether the extra compliance is worth it.
If you are deciding how to file 1099 taxes, the first pass should be basic classification and cash reserve discipline. If you are comparing best tax software for gig workers 2026 options, use software to enforce the process you already chose, not to replace it.
